PORTER, Anna Maria. Sailor's Friendship, and a Soldier's
Love, A (1805)
Contemporary Reviews
Monthly Review, 2nd ser. 50 (June 1806): 220.
This is not as it appears to be, a double title to the same story:
the sailor’s friendship and the soldier’s love being
exemplified in two short tales, which indeed have but little interest
in them. It is true that the sailor parts with his mistress in order
to preserve his Friend, and the soldier sacrifices his estate in
order to possess his Love!—which certainly are serious circumstances
in real life, but trifles in a modern novel.
Notes: Listed under ‘Monthly Catalogue: Novels’. Format:
2 vols 12mo; price 8s. Boards. Publisher: Longman & Co.
